What's Bunkering?
Bunkering refers to the whole process of providing fuel—commonly maritime fuel oil or maritime gas oil—to ships. This Procedure can take place at sea, in port, or through pipeline infrastructure. Gasoline is typically saved in tanks on board a vessel named bunkers, consequently the term.
There are 3 primary different types of bunkering operations:
Port Bunkering – Usually takes area when ships are docked.
STS (Ship-to-Ship) Transfer – Fuel is provided from just one vessel to another at sea.
Offshore Bunkering – Generally requires source at anchorage points working with bunker barges.
Bunkering is not only a mechanical endeavor—it’s a vital logistical Procedure that straight influences the timing, efficiency, and fees of maritime transport.
Who're Bunker Suppliers?
Bunker suppliers are corporations that physically provide gas to vessels. They are often port-based mostly entities that individual the gasoline stocks or perform in partnership with oil refineries. These suppliers may perhaps operate their own personal fleet of bunker barges and possess immediate associations with terminal operators.
What Bunker Suppliers Do:
Obtain maritime gas from refineries or traders
Retail outlet the gasoline in port tanks
Arrange for delivery through barge, truck, or pipeline
Carry out excellent and amount checks
Provide documentation like bunker delivery notes (BDN)
Effectively-established bunker suppliers make certain timely shipping and delivery of the best grade of gas, meeting IMO specifications like the 0.50% sulfur cap enforced in 2020.
The Part of Bunker Traders
Although suppliers take care of Bodily shipping and delivery, bunker traders are classified as the intermediaries who negotiate charges, supply the highest quality fuel, and coordinate the general transaction concerning shipowners and suppliers. They Participate in an important position in connecting world-wide shipping and delivery providers with vetted area suppliers.
What Bunker Traders Give:
Use of world-wide markets and port protection
Authentic-time price tag comparison and negotiation
Threat management and hedging procedures
Credit rating facilities and versatile payment phrases
Expertise in gasoline good quality and polices
Leading bunker traders check fluctuations in bunker prices and give strategic purchasing assistance which will help fleet operators conserve tens of millions every year.
Comprehending Bunker Prices
Bunker selling prices consult with the expense for each metric ton of maritime gasoline, which differs noticeably by fuel form, port place, and world wide oil markets. The two most commonly encountered varieties of maritime fuels are:
HSFO (Higher Sulfur Gas Oil) – Now confined because of IMO restrictions.
VLSFO (Very Minimal Sulfur Gas Oil) – Compliant with the 0.50% sulfur cap.
MGO (Marine Gasoline Oil) – A cleaner, additional refined but costlier gasoline.
Elements Influencing Bunker Charges:
Crude Oil Price ranges – Gasoline costs usually mirror world wide crude oil industry developments.
Area Supply and Demand – Port-particular dynamics can influence availability and selling price.
Storage and Supply Costs – Consists of barge expenses, port dues, and insurance.
Currency Trade Rates – Especially in international trading ports.
Regulations and Compliance – Sulfur caps and emissions requirements improve expenses.
Bunkering costs may vary significantly in between ports. As an example, Singapore, Rotterdam, and Fujairah are known for aggressive pricing as a consequence of high volumes and infrastructure performance.
How Bunkering Selling prices Are Quoted
Bunkering charges are typically quoted in USD for every metric ton (MT). Such as:
VLSFO in Singapore: $660/MT
MGO in Rotterdam: $880/MT
Selling prices could possibly be supplied as:
Set Price Contracts – Pre-agreed amount for the set interval.
Floating Value Contracts – According to real-time current market indices.
Spot Sector Charges – Immediate pricing for speedy deliveries.
Knowledge these pricing structures can help ship operators choose the finest procurement method, balancing Price tag, usefulness, and regulatory compliance.
Importance of Transparency from the Bunkering Business
In past times, the bunkering sector was suffering from difficulties like amount disputes, gasoline adulteration, and pricing opacity. Nevertheless, greater digitalization and regulatory oversight are bringing A lot-essential transparency.
Mass Flow Meters (MFM) are now Utilized Bunkering Prices in critical ports like Singapore to make sure correct measurement.
Bunker Shipping Notes (BDNs) are standardized for better document-trying to keep.
Digital Bunker Platforms like BunkerEx and Integr8 streamline rate comparisons and fuel procurement globally.
Shipowners now need verifiable excellent, on-time supply, and clear bunkering costs—and the market is evolving to meet People expectations.

Environmental Factors in Bunkering
With all the Intercontinental Maritime Group (IMO) pushing for cleaner oceans, the bunkering market can also be going through a eco-friendly transformation. Shipping and delivery firms and bunker traders are now Discovering:
Biofuels: Renewable and sustainable marine fuels
LNG (Liquefied Pure Gas): Decreased emissions but infrastructure-large
Methanol and Ammonia: Future fuels in progress
Scrubbers: Devices that clear away sulfur from emissions (for Bunkering Prices HSFO consumers)
These possibilities influence bunkering prices and therefore are switching the dynamics of provide and desire throughout international ports.
